Eva Longoria’s baby son is ‘easy and sweet’

Eva Longoria’s baby son is so "easy and sweet."
The former ‘Desperate Housewives’ star gave birth to her little boy Santiago Enrique, whom she has with her husband Jose ‘Pepe’ Baston, seven weeks ago and has admitted she can’t get over how much of a "dream" the tiny tot is.
Speaking to ‘Entertainment Tonight’, she said: "He’s a dream, and he’s such a good baby. I knock on wood. He’s just been so easy, so sweet, we’ve been really lucky, he’s super healthy. It’s just been great. Everything he does is cute. His noises he makes, his smile. He’s finding his voice, so he makes all these funny [baby noises], you’re just like, ‘What was that?’ He talks a lot. I mean, he just wants to talk and talk.
"What’s amazing is seeing him grow so much from just your breast milk. And I’m like, ‘This is crazy! All you’re eating is what’s coming out of my body and you’re just like doubled in size. And it’s going way too fast already."
But now that Santiago is getting older, the 43-year-old star is starting to think about returning to work and she’s worried that she won’t have time to juggle everything.
She explained: "So now comes the part where, as I start returning back to work slowly, [I’m asking], ‘How do you balance it all?’ Everybody used to [ask] me, ‘How do you do it all? You do so many things? And I was just like, ‘Because I don’t have kids.’ I mean every project was my baby and now I actually have a baby.
"When people go, ‘Your mother instincts kick in,’ that’s true. I mean you become a natural. But I’ve been a mom to so many in my life already. My nieces, my nephews, girls through my foundation. I’m very well educated in this arena.
"I mean. I made sure I was, I took every class you could take, I read all the books I watched all the videos, and I still continued to learn."
And there’s a possibility that Eva and Pepe – who got marred in 2016 – may have more children in the future but right now she’s still "recovering" from her first pregnancy.
She said: "Oh gosh, you know what, let me recover from this one. It’s too soon to tell."
